Paddington Bear

I remember watching this stop motion animated short features made in 1975 on tv as a kid. A combination of animated 3-d and 2-d card board cutouts for the characters, and the  backgrounds were cut outs as well. Created in 1975 by Mr. Ivor Wood and narrated by Mr. Michael Horden, A friendly young bear from Darkest Parue  had stowed away to find a better life, as his aunt Lucie bear was in a home for retired bears. While he made it to a  London  train station, the Brown family had taken notice of him and decided to take him into their home and cared for him, and decided to name him Paddington as that was the name of the train station they were at. Paddington bear wore a large black folded had, a blue trench coat and often carried a suit case with him containing the things he needed. Life in London was very difficult for Paddington as  at first, as he wasn't used to all the modern conveniences of home life. Of course a lot of his day to day living was learning new things and skills in life, and often getting into large predicaments and sticky situations, even stickier than the jar of marmalade that he absolutely loved to eat as a sandwich. Often, he tries to help his next door neighbor Mr. Curry, whom doesn't often take kindly to Paddington, as he often makes huge messes and breaks things, but not on purpose.          Of course Paddington has had  many adventures when shopping down town. In one episode he was taken to a department store by Mrs. Brown and  their maid to get new pajamas. Of course it was difficult to find the right size for Paddington, but the store clerk seemed helpful but confused, but allowed Paddington to go to a fitting room to try on the pajamas. Paddington had problems finding an open and empty room, but managed to get into a room that was all set up for a bedroom. Paddington thought it was much too fancy for a simple fitting room, and got into his pajamas and went to the bed and fell asleep. Later that day, he woke up to a sound of people, as they were all watching him sleeping in the bed from outside the  store display window. But Paddington didn't realize that he was in a store display window and not a fitting room. As a result, those very same pajamas he wore had sold like hotcakes and were in huge demand.  There are lots of fun adventures that this brown fun loving bear has, and often get into mischief that will make you laugh.
